Football News Update: USMNT Underperforms at Copa America Despite Favorable Group

The U.S. men’s national team’s (USMNT) recent outing at the Copa America tournament has left football fans and analysts alike deeply disappointed. Despite being placed in a seemingly favorable group featuring Bolivia, Panama, and Uruguay, the USMNT failed to meet expectations, resulting in an early exit from the competition.

The tournament started promisingly with a win over Bolivia, but the team’s momentum quickly unraveled. The 10-men USMNT crumbled against Panama, and in the decisive match against Uruguay, Gregg Berhalter’s side was unable to muster the necessary goals to secure advancement.
